Ingredients List
Here’s what you’ll need to create your mouthwatering Peach Salsa Chicken. Each ingredient plays a vital role in bringing out those delicious flavors, so let’s get into it!
- 4 chicken fillet: Boneless and skinless is best for this recipe. They’ll grill up juicy and tender!
- 2 ripe peaches, diced: Make sure they’re perfectly ripe for that sweet, juicy flavor. Dice them into small pieces for a delightful burst in every bite.
- 1/2 red onion, diced: This adds a nice crunch and a bit of sweetness. Dice it finely so it mixes well with the salsa.
- 1 jalapeño, minced: For that spicy kick! You can adjust the amount based on your heat preference. I love a little heat, but if you’re sensitive, feel free to use less or even omit it.
- 1/4 cup cilantro, chopped: Fresh cilantro is a must! It brightens up the dish and complements the peaches beautifully.
- 1 lime, juiced: Fresh lime juice adds a zesty tang that really brings all the flavors together. Don’t skimp on this one!
- Salt and pepper to taste: Simple, but crucial. A little seasoning goes a long way in enhancing the flavors of both the chicken and the salsa.

How to Prepare Peach Salsa Chicken
Now that you’ve gathered your ingredients, let’s dive into the fun part—preparing this amazing Peach Salsa Chicken! I promise, it’s super straightforward, and you’ll love how the flavors come together.
Season the Chicken
First things first, let’s talk about seasoning. This step is crucial because it sets the stage for all that delicious flavor! I like to generously sprinkle salt and pepper on both sides of the chicken fillet. Don’t be shy with it! A good amount of seasoning really enhances the natural flavor of the chicken, making it juicy and mouthwatering.
Cooking the Chicken
Now for the cooking part! You can grill or pan-sear the chicken, depending on what you’re in the mood for. If you’re grilling, preheat your grill to medium-high heat. Place the seasoned chicken on the grill, and cook for about 6-7 minutes on each side. You want those lovely grill marks and juicy insides! If you’re pan-searing, heat a tablespoon of oil in a skillet over medium heat, and cook the chicken for about the same time—just until it’s cooked through and no longer pink inside. Use a meat thermometer if you want to be precise; it should read 165°F (75°C) when done. Trust me, the aroma will have your mouth watering!
Making the Peach Salsa
While the chicken is cooking, it’s the perfect time to whip up that fabulous peach salsa! In a bowl, combine the diced peaches, red onion, minced jalapeño, chopped cilantro, and lime juice. Mix everything gently but thoroughly—this salsa is all about that fresh, vibrant flavor! Make sure to taste it, and if you want a bit more heat, you can always add more jalapeño. The ripe peaches are the star here, so you want their sweetness to shine through. Wow, the smell alone will get you excited!

Tips for Success
Ready to take your Peach Salsa Chicken to the next level? I’ve got some insider tips that will make your dish absolutely shine! Following these little nuggets of wisdom will ensure you achieve the best results every time.
- Select the Right Peaches: Choose ripe, fragrant peaches that yield slightly to pressure. They should be sweet and juicy, making all the difference in your salsa. If they’re a bit firm, you can leave them at room temperature for a day or two until they soften up.
- Adjust the Spice Level: If you’re not a fan of heat, feel free to use just a pinch of jalapeño or omit it entirely. On the flip side, if you love a good kick, add some diced serrano peppers or a sprinkle of red pepper flakes to amp up the spice!
- Marinate for Extra Flavor: If you have a bit more time, consider marinating the chicken in lime juice, salt, and pepper for about 30 minutes before cooking. This adds an extra layer of flavor that pairs beautifully with the peach salsa.
- Experiment with Herbs: While cilantro is a classic addition, don’t hesitate to swap it out for fresh basil or mint if you’re feeling adventurous! Each herb brings its unique twist to the dish.
- Serve It Fresh: This dish is best enjoyed fresh. While leftovers can still be tasty, the salsa’s vibrant flavors are at their peak right after it’s made. Try to prepare it just before serving for maximum deliciousness.
- Pair with the Right Sides: Complement this dish with sides that enhance its flavors! Think about adding a light quinoa salad or grilled vegetables to round out your meal.

FAQ Section
Got questions about Peach Salsa Chicken? You’re not alone! Here are some of the most common queries I’ve heard, along with my answers to help you make the most of this delicious dish.
Can I use frozen peaches instead of fresh?
Absolutely! If fresh peaches aren’t available, you can use frozen ones. Just make sure to thaw and drain them before dicing. The flavor might be slightly different, but it’ll still be tasty!
How should I store leftovers?
Store any leftover Peach Salsa Chicken in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. The salsa is best enjoyed fresh, but it can still be used as a topping for salads or wraps later on!
Can I substitute chicken thighs for chicken fillet?
Yes, chicken thighs work wonderfully in this recipe! They’ll add a bit more richness and flavor. Just keep an eye on the cooking time, as thighs may take a few extra minutes to cook through.
What can I serve with this dish?
This dish pairs perfectly with rice, tortillas, or a light salad. You can also serve it alongside grilled veggies for a complete summer feast!
How spicy is this dish?
The spice level largely depends on how much jalapeño you add. If you’re sensitive to heat, start with half the amount and taste as you go. You can always add more if you want that extra kick!
Can I make this dish ahead of time?
You can prep the salsa ahead of time and store it in the fridge for a day. But I recommend cooking the chicken fresh for the best flavor and texture. It’s quick to whip up, so it’ll be worth it!
Can I use different fruits in the salsa?
Definitely! Feel free to mix it up with other fruits like mango, pineapple, or even berries. Just make sure they’re ripe and sweet to complement the dish beautifully.
Is this recipe gluten-free?
Yes, Peach Salsa Chicken is naturally gluten-free! Just be sure to check any additional ingredients, especially sauces or sides, to ensure they meet your dietary needs.

Peach Salsa Chicken: 7 Fresh Ways to Impress Your Guests
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
- Total Time: 35 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Category: Main Course
- Method: Grilling or Searing
- Cuisine: American
- Diet: Gluten Free
Description
A flavorful dish combining chicken with fresh peach salsa.
Ingredients
- 4 chicken fillet
- 2 ripe peaches, diced
- 1/2 red onion, diced
- 1 jalapeño, minced
- 1/4 cup cilantro, chopped
- 1 lime, juiced
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Season the chicken fillet with salt and pepper.
- Grill or pan-sear the chicken until cooked through.
- In a bowl, combine diced peaches, red onion, jalapeño, cilantro, and lime juice.
- Mix well to create the salsa.
- Serve the chicken topped with peach salsa.
Notes
- Use ripe peaches for best flavor.
- Adjust jalapeño for desired heat level.
- This dish pairs well with rice or tortillas.
